  • Diesel and kerosene prices unchanged

The Ceylon Petroleum Corporation (CPC) has slashed petrol prices by up to Rs. 20 per litre, while keeping diesel and kerosene prices unchanged.

The price of Petrol 92 was reduced with effect from yesterday by Rs. 15 per litre to Rs. 399 from Rs. 414, while Petrol 95 was cut by Rs. 20 to Rs. 475 from Rs. 495 per litre.

The revised prices came into effect from midnight on 30 August.

The CPC said there would be no change in the prices of Auto Diesel, Super Diesel, and kerosene. Accordingly, the islandwide retail price of Auto Diesel remains at Rs. 382 per litre, Super Diesel at Rs. 478, and kerosene at Rs. 285.
